基于局地气候环境优化的采育镇空间规划研究
Study for Spatial Plan in Caiyu Town on Urban-climate Environment Optimization
【作者】 王鹏;
【作者基本信息】 清华大学 , 城市规划(专业学位), 2014, 硕士
【摘要】 气候环境与城镇建设活动相互影响、息息相关。一方面,地理纬度、山川地形等自然要素塑造了地域的气候环境,进而在风、日照、温度、降水、湿度等方面影响着城镇的选址建设、功能结构、形态布局。另一方面,城镇建设活动对城镇的局地气候环境也具有重要的影响。随着城镇开发建设活动的不断开展,城镇形态产生了巨大变化,生产生活过程的人为排热逐渐增多,这些因素改变了城镇的下垫面属性、影响了自然气候条件,从而逐渐塑造出特殊的城镇局地气候状况。近年来,随着城镇的快速发展,京津冀地区的城镇气候环境问题逐渐凸显,正迅速成为城镇健康发展的严峻挑战。从夏季的持续高温、到暴雨倾城、再到最近的连续雾霾天气等,无不与气候问题息息相关,受到广泛关注。不仅如此,随着城镇气候环境的恶化,还会提高空调等设备的使用频率、增加能源消耗,进而对全球气候变化起到推波助澜的作用。土地利用变化、人为排热增加等城镇建设因素是导致京津冀地区气候问题的重要原因。因此,如何在规划设计过程中,进一步关注气候环境与城镇建设活动的关系,并综合考虑地域的自然气候条件、构建合理的城市系统、最终达到改善气候环境的目的是本文主要探讨的问题。采育镇位于北京东南部地区、京津发展轴上,毗邻市域的重要发展备用地——永乐组团,与河北廊坊、天津武清相接,同时与大兴新城、亦庄新城联系紧密;作为北京市的重点建设小城镇之一,采育镇是区域在未来重要的城镇化拓展区。本文以采育镇为研究对象,以实际工程项目为依托,在区域气候环境恶化的大背景下,研究如何通过空间规划手段合理应对气候问题、改善局地气候环境。在规划过程中,运用CFD模拟软件对现状建设情况与规划设计方案进行模拟分析,帮助找到现状问题,并验证规划设计方案的合理性与适用性。
【Abstract】 Climate and urban construction activity are closely related to each otherand influence each other. On the one hand, geographical latitude, terrain, andother natural elements shaped regional climates, and then, wind, sunshine,temperature, precipitation, humidity affected the location, construction andlayout of town. On the other hand, urban construction activity also had animportant influence on local climate. The development of city made urban formchange greatly and anthropogenic heat grow continuously, which changed theproperties of underlying surface in city, influenced the natural climate, andgradually created a special urban climate conditions.In recent years, with rapid urbanization, the problem of urabn climate inBeijing-Tianjin-Hebei region is becoming more and more serious, whichchallenges the healthy development. Dust in spring, high temperature and heavyrain in summer, and haze in winter, which are all closely related to climate,have been widely concerned. Besides that, deterioration of urban climateenvironment will improve the frequency of using air conditioning equipment,and increase energy consumption, which play a negative role on global climatechange. Therefore, paying more attention on the relationship between climateand urban construction activities in the process of planning and design, andlooking for a way to construct a reasonable urban system which will improvethe climate environment based on integrated natural climate condition is thepurpose of this paper.Caiyu Town is located in the southeast of Beijing, and also in the Beijing-Tianjin Development Axis. It is an important part of Yongle, which is a spareland for development in Beijing. Caiyu is adjacent to Langfang that is in HebeiProvince, Wuqing which is in Tianjin, and closely linked to Daxing new town,Yizhuang new town. It is also one of the important small towns in Beijing,which will play a major role on urbanization in this area. Based on actualengineering project about Caiyu Town, this paper will study how to improve thelocal climate environmen from the perspective of urban planning in thebackground of regional climate deterioration.
